  • Division is a fundamental arithmetic operation that involves sharing a certain number of items into equal groups. When you divide 9 by 5, you're essentially sharing 9 units into 5 equal groups. To find the exact result, you need to perform the division operation. Let's break it down step by step:

    • Some people might assume that dividing 9 by 5 will always result in a whole number. However, the exact result of 9 divided by 5 is a decimal number, 1.8, which might lead to confusion. It's essential to understand that division can produce decimal results, especially when dealing with fractions or decimals.
